Next: Restructuring Up: Background reading Previous: Background reading

Background reading, cont'd

Monica Lam's group at Stanford have used these ideas to build a public-domain prototype compiler system ``SUIF''. The following paper describes how SUIF uses unimodular transformations to optimise locality:

M.E. Wolf and M.S. Lam, ``A data locality optimizing algorithm'' [].
The Stanford work overcomes many of the restrictions of Banerjee's paper, but lies beyond the scope of this course.



Paul H J Kelly Thu Dec 4 18:15:31 GMT 1997